The Lizard Orchid
The Lizard Orchid - Himantoglossum orchid. Its roots are represented by two tubercles, one big, one small. In the 18th century in France, it was recommended that ladies wear a dried orchid tuber of Himantoglossum as a talisman to protect them from amorous impulses. Whether this was to protect them from their own impulses or those of interested men is not entirely clear.
